Siemens SCALANCE and RUGGEDCOM Devices Improper Input Validation (CVE-2024-56568)
iommu/arm-smmu: Defer probe of clients after smmu device bound Null pointer dereference occurs due to a race between smmu driver probe and client driver probe, when ofdmaconfigure for client is called after the iommudeviceregister for smmu driver probe has executed but before the driverbound for...
